[PATCH] PNP/ACPI: Fix string truncation warning

From: Sunil V L
Date: Tue Jul 25 2023 - 01:29:43 EST


LKP reports below warning when building for RISC-V.

drivers/pnp/pnpacpi/core.c:253:17:
warning: 'strncpy' specified bound 50 equals destination
size [-Wstringop-truncation]

This appears like a valid issue since the destination
string may not be null-terminated. To fix this, append
the NUL explicitly after the strncpy.

diff --git a/drivers/pnp/pnpacpi/core.c b/drivers/pnp/pnpacpi/core.c
index 38928ff7472b..6ab272c84b7b 100644
--- a/drivers/pnp/pnpacpi/core.c
+++ b/drivers/pnp/pnpacpi/core.c
@@ -254,6 +254,9 @@ static int __init pnpacpi_add_device(struct acpi_device *device)
else
strncpy(dev->name, acpi_device_bid(device), sizeof(dev->name));

+ /* Handle possible string truncation */
+ dev->name[sizeof(dev->name) - 1] = '\0';
+
if (dev->active)
pnpacpi_parse_allocated_resource(dev);
